Abstract

The invention discloses ancient building restoration 3D printing equipment. The ancient building restoration 3D printing equipment comprises a base, a movable bottom plate, limiting blocks, limiting grooves, a rolling wheel, a protective shell, an inspection window, a movable baffle, displacement mechanisms, placement plates, stepping motors, slide grooves, slide blocks, rotation rods, vertical columns and a printing head. The ancient building restoration 3D printing equipment has the beneficial effects that the movable bottom plate is arranged in a concave groove formed in the base in a push-pull mode, the movable bottom plate can be pulled out form the interior of the protective shell, and accordingly, a printed object is conveniently taken out; the vertical columns are fixed to slide blocks of the displacement mechanisms located on the two sides of the base so as to be arranged in a front-back moving mode; the displacement mechanisms which are located on the base and arranged horizontally are fixed to the slide blocks of the vertically-arranged displacement mechanisms so as to be arranged in an up-down moving mode; and the printing head is fixed to the slide blocks of the horizontally-arranged displacement mechanisms located on the base so as to be arranged in a left-right moving mode, and three-dimensional moving of the printing head can be achieved.

technical field [0001] The invention relates to a 3D printing device, in particular to a 3D printing device for restoring ancient buildings, and belongs to the technical field of 3D printing. Background technique [0002] my country's ancient architecture has a long history, and its unique construction style and structure also occupy a very important position in the history of world construction, and its scientific value and artistry are even more immeasurable. Ancient buildings are also left over from long-term historical development, and cannot be regenerated or rebuilt. If they are damaged, they cannot be recovered. In the historical development, due to the influence of natural or human factors, ancient buildings have been damaged or even destroyed. Therefore, effective restoration and protection measures must be taken to make the cultural heritage of ancient buildings appear for a long time.
